Optical absorption and disorder in delafossites
2017
We present compelling experimental results of the optical characteristics of transparent oxide CuGaO2 and related CuGa1-xFexO2 (with 0.00≤x≤0.05) alloys, whereby the forbidden electronic transitions for CuGaO2 become permissible in the presence of B-site (Ga sites) alloying with Fe. Our computational structural results imply a correlation between the global strain on the system and a decreased optical absorption edge. However, herein, we show that the relatively ordered CuGa1-xFexO2 (for 0.00≤x≤0.04) structures exhibit much weaker vis-absorption compared to the relatively disordered CuGa0.95Fe0.05O2.
